T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the field of medical devices, in particular to the field of endoscopes, and more particularly to a bending tube device combining metal and rubber. BACKGROUND
[0002] At present, the bending tube used in endoscopes is basically composed of each stainless steel ring joint through riveting principle. Since the inner and outer diameters of the bending tube are closely related to the amount of the hidden objects in the bending tube, the use of stainless steel through laser cutting method is also used to increase the space, and the traction wire is also inserted in the form of punching groove and welded on the first section of the bending tube. The laser cutting bending tube does not use rivets but cuts a certain width for bending to replace the role of rivets. However, the biggest risk of this laser cutting is that because the elastic stainless steel material is used, the cutting part will form a knife edge after breaking, which will seriously damage the surface of the cavity when the endoscope exits the human body. There are also various forms of bending tubes formed by connecting the concave-convex grooves after plastic die casting. Since the thickness and internal structure of the insertion tube of the endoscope have a close size relationship, in the case of thin diameter, how to ensure the large inner diameter space has been a problem for the designers of endoscopes. The new laser cutting or plastic die casting bending tube without rivets has obvious defects and deficiencies. SUMMARY
[0003] The present application overcomes the above-mentioned shortcomings of the prior art and provides a bending tube device combining metal and rubber, which is simple in structure, convenient to use and widely applicable.
[0004] In order to ach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the bending tube device combining metal and rubber of the present application is as follows:
[0005] The bending tube device combining metal and rubber, which mainly comprises a metal joint ring, a special-shaped mesh rubber part and a traction wire assembly, the metal joint ring and the special-shaped mesh rubber part are connected as a bending assembly through hot melt rubber, a plurality of bending assemblies are combined to form a bending tube, the traction wire assembly is inserted into the steel wire limiting groove of each metal joint ring, and the other end of the traction wire assembly pulls the bending tube to bend in different directions.
[0006] Preferably, the traction wire assembly comprises a limiting head and a traction wire, and the limiting head is installed at the front end of the traction wire.
[0007] Preferably, the inner side of the metal joint ring has a traction wire limiting groove, the limiting head at the front end of the traction wire assembly is fixed on the traction wire limiting groove of the front joint of the bending tube, and the diameter of the limiting head is greater than the diameter of the traction wire limiting groove.
[0008] Preferably, the traction steel wire limiting groove is a slope type, and the groove has a downwardly inclined slope.
[0009] Preferably, the metal ring has two or four traction steel wire limiting grooves uniformly distributed thereon.
[0010] Preferably, the metal ring has a plurality of micro-holes at the joint of the metal ring and the profiled net-shaped rubber piece, and the metal ring and the profiled net-shaped rubber piece are tightly fixed through the plurality of micro-holes.
[0011] Preferably, the profiled net-shaped rubber piece has a plurality of profiled net-shaped rubber structures, the profiled net-shaped rubber structures have gaps in the middle, and the profiled net-shaped rubber structures protrude from the surface of the profiled net-shaped rubber piece and have a rebounding force.
[0012] Preferably, the device further comprises a front curved tube connector and a rear curved tube connector, the front curved tube connector is installed in front of the frontmost profiled net-shaped rubber piece, and the rear curved tube connector is installed behind the rearmost profiled net-shaped rubber piece.
[0013] The curved tube device for combining metal and rubber of the present application has the advantages that the combination of the stainless steel ring and the rubber ensures the size relationship of the inner diameter and the outer diameter ratio and avoids potential risks that may be caused by the use of a laser cutting method, the device is disposable, the complicated process is reduced, the cost is greatly reduced, and the device is suitable for wide application in a thin diameter endoscope. [0039] In a specific embodiment of the present invention, a bending tube device combining metal and rubber is disclosed, which is an integrated bending tube assembly composed of a metal connecting ring, a special-shaped mesh rubber component, and a traction steel wire assembly with a limit at the front end.
[0040] The metal-rubber combined bending tube device of the present invention includes a metal coupling ring, an irregular mesh rubber component, and a traction steel wire assembly with a limit at the front end. Typically, in embodiments of the present invention, the metal coupling ring is a curved stainless steel tube coupling ring with a grooved process hole.
[0041] The metal coupling and the irregularly shaped mesh rubber component are connected by hot-melt rubber to form a flexible assembly. After the assembly is completed, the traction wire assembly is inserted into the groove of each section, and the front end is fixed to the traction wire limiting groove connected to the front of the bending tube. The bending tube is pulled and bent in different directions at the other end of the wire, and the bending shape and the bending angles in the up and down directions (or the four directions of up, down, left, and right) are observed to see if they meet the design requirements.
[0042] The curved surface of the metal connector is designed to increase the area available for bonding with the rubber, thereby enhancing its strength.
[0043] The groove space of the metal coupling has the function of releasing pressure when the tube is bent, avoiding the risk of detachment caused by the accumulation of pressure and stress after bending and the formation of shear force.
[0044] When the metal connector is die-cast and assembled with the irregular mesh rubber part, there are micro-holes at the joint between the metal connector and the irregular mesh rubber part. The purpose of these holes is to ensure that the metal connector is tightly fixed to the irregular mesh rubber part and to prevent the risk of falling off when pulled in a straight line.
[0045] The front of the curved tube has two grooves with beveled surfaces, and the diameter of the limiting head at the front end of the traction wire assembly is larger than the diameter of the grooves. This ensures that the wire rope will not be pulled off when the traction wire assembly is under tension.
[0046] The rubber fused to the metal ring has an irregular mesh structure. The gaps in its special mesh structure prevent the rubber from squeezing against each other when bent, and at the same time provide elasticity when released.
[0047] The circular protrusions of the mesh structure serve two purposes: first, to absorb stress when bent; and second, to fix each other in place when stretched to prevent the bending direction from shifting.
[0048] The gap spacing of the mesh structure of the rubber component is designed according to different bending angles.
[0049] The gaps in the mesh structure of the rubber component ensure both the bending angles in the upper and lower directions and keep the bent tube in the same plane when bending.
[0050] This invention uses a mold processing method combined with snake bone and rubber to replace the traditional riveting method, thereby realizing the function of bending pipe.
[0051] The advantages of curved tubes synthesized by die casting are that the straightness can be controlled and the flexibility during bending can be adjusted according to the hardness of the rubber, overcoming the disadvantage of the difficulty in controlling the tightness of traditional riveting methods.
[0052] Using rubber as an alternative to riveting can avoid the risk of sharp metal burrs caused by improper riveting, which could damage internal components during bending or puncture the outer rubber covering, leading to water leakage and other quality instability issues.
